Christian book clubs are groups of individuals who come together to discuss and study Christian literature, typically focusing on books that explore faith, theology, and spirituality.
Key Features
- Discussion of Christian literature
- Opportunity for fellowship and community
- Learning and growth in faith
Pros
- Fosters deep discussions about faith and spirituality
- Provides a sense of community and support for members
- Encourages reading and learning about Christian principles
Cons
- May not appeal to those who do not identify as Christian
- Potential for group dynamics issues or disagreements on interpretations of texts
